First off, let's talk about the initial stage of quarrying: exploration. Before any machine starts doing its thing, geologists and surveyors have to figure out where the good - quality stone deposits are. They use all sorts of high - tech tools like ground - penetrating radar and satellite imagery. Once they've pinpointed a promising site, that's when our stone quarry machines come into play.
The primary job of a stone quarry machine is to extract the stone from the ground. There are different types of machines for this, depending on the type of stone and the quarry's layout. For instance, some quarries use drill and blast methods. Here, drilling machines bore holes into the rock, and then explosives are placed in these holes. After the blast, the broken stone is ready for further processing.

At the processing area, the stone goes through a series of steps to turn it into a finished product. First, it's crushed. Crushers are used to break the large stone blocks into smaller pieces. The size of the crushed stone depends on its intended use. For example, if it's going to be used for road construction, it will be crushed into gravel - sized pieces. Next, the crushed stone might go through a screening process. Screens separate the stone pieces by size. This is important because different applications require different sizes of stone. For example, for making concrete, you need a specific mix of different - sized stone particles.
